is a landmark song in French music history, famously recorded in 2000 by singer Daniel Lévi for the musical Les Dix Commandements . Composed by Pascal Obispo with lyrics by Lionel Florence and Patrice Guirao , the track became a monumental success, remaining one of the best-selling singles of all time in France.
